JD Vance, a recent Catholic convert and Vice President, criticized the US Conference of Catholic Bishops for opposing the administration’s immigration policy, accusing them of financial motivations. This highlights a growing divide between the MAGA movement and the Catholic Church, with conflicting views on immigrants, economic justice, nationalism, and the common good. Despite some Catholics aligning with conservative positions, the tension between Catholic teaching and MAGA policies is becoming increasingly apparent, especially among younger Catholics who prioritize values like dignity, inclusion, and care for creation.
